The National Human Rights Commission (NHRC) took suo motu cognizance of a fire incident on October 6, 2025, at Jaipur's Sawai Man Singh Hospital, which resulted in eight patient deaths and three critical injuries.
The Commission observed that the incident raised serious human rights violation issues and issued notices to Rajasthan's Chief Secretary and DGP, seeking a detailed report, including compensation for victims.
